Word 2003, Outlook 2003. The central repository of our contact information
is in Outlook Contacts. I need to be able to mail merge from these contacts much in the same way I would from an Access database. I need to be able to query the contacts by Category, and by other fields in the contact information. So here is the question. How may I mail merge from Outlook Contacts in the way I describe? I already know how to do a Word mail merge initiating from Outlook. I need to be able to initiate it from Word. You can only do this from Outlook as many of the fields (Categories for
example) are not available when merging from Word. http://www.gmayor.com/mailmerge_from_outlook.htm -- Graham Mayor - Word MVP My web site www.gmayor.com Word MVP web site http://word.mvps.org Chaplain Doug wrote: Word 2003, Outlook 2003.
